GPU comparison with benchmarksThe ZOTAC GeForce GTX 1080 Ti Blower has 3584 shader units and these clock a maximum of 1.58 GHz which results in an FP32 computing power of 11.34 TFLOPS.
The PNY GeForce RTX 3060 UPRISING DUAL FAN has 3584 shader units and these clock at a maximum of 1.78 GHz and achieve an FP32 computing power of 12.72 TFLOPS. |
||
GPUThe ZOTAC GeForce GTX 1080 Ti Blower is equipped with a graphics chip of the Pascal architecture, which has 28 streaming multiprocessors. The graphics card PNY GeForce RTX 3060 UPRISING DUAL FAN is based on the Ampere architecture and is equipped with 28 execution units. |

MemoryThe ZOTAC GeForce GTX 1080 Ti Blower is equipped with a 11 GB large GDDR5X graphics memory, which is equipped with 1.376 GHz clocks. The PNY GeForce RTX 3060 UPRISING DUAL FAN has a 12 GB large GDDR6 graphics memory and the memory clock is 1.875GHz. |

Thermal DesignThe ZOTAC GeForce GTX 1080 Ti Blower has 1 x 6-Pin, 1 x 8-Pin connectors through which it is supplied with power. The manufacturer specifies the maximum operating temperature of the graphics card as 91 °C. The PNY GeForce RTX 3060 UPRISING DUAL FAN is equipped with a 1 x 8-Pin PCIe power connector that supplies it with power. The maximum operating temperature of the card is 93 °C. |

Additional dataManufactured using the 16 nanometer process, ZOTAC GeForce GTX 1080 Ti Blower was released in Q1/2017. The PNY GeForce RTX 3060 UPRISING DUAL FAN published in Q1/2021 is manufactured with a structure width of 8 nanometers. |
